Sinkhole filling services involve the stabilization and repair of ground areas that have experienced sudden collapses or subsidence, often caused by underlying soil erosion, water flow, or other geological factors. Professionals in this field assess the extent of the sinkhole, determine the appropriate materials for filling, and implement solutions designed to restore the ground’s integrity. The process typically includes excavating loose debris, preparing the site, and filling the void with suitable materials such as compacted soil, gravel, or other engineered substances to prevent further collapse. These services aim to provide a stable surface that can support structures, driveways, lawns, or other property features.
Addressing sinkholes helps resolve a variety of property issues, including uneven ground surfaces, structural damage, and safety hazards. Unstable soil can threaten the foundation of nearby buildings, cause cracks in pavement or walls, and pose risks to residents or visitors. Filling a sinkhole not only restores the property’s appearance but also reduces the likelihood of future ground subsidence or additional collapses. Properly performed sinkhole filling can help mitigate costly repairs and prevent potential accidents caused by sudden ground failures.

The overview below groups typical Sinkhole Filling proj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Rock Hill, SC.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Filling Costs - The cost for sinkhole filling services typically ranges from $2,000 to $10,000, depending on the size and depth of the sinkhole. Smaller projects in residential areas might be closer to $2,500, while larger commercial sites can exceed $8,000.
Material Expenses - The price of materials used for filling, such as gravel, soil, or specialized fill, generally adds between $500 and $3,000 to the overall cost. Material choice and quantity significantly influence the total expenses.
Labor Charges - Labor costs for sinkhole filling services usually fall between $1,000 and $5,000, based on project complexity and site accessibility. More intricate or extensive work tends to push costs toward the higher end of the range.
Additional Fees - Extra costs may include site preparation, permits, or environmental mitigation, which can add $500 to $2,500. These factors vary depending on local regulations and specific project requirements.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es a sinkhole to form? Sinkholes can develop due to natural underground erosion or changes in the soil, often exacerbated by heavy rainfall or human activities that disturb the ground.
How do professionals fill sinkholes? Experts typically assess the site and then use specialized materials and techniques to stabilize and fill the void, preventing further ground collapse.
Is sinkhole filling safe for my property? When performed by experienced service providers, sinkhole filling is designed to stabilize the ground and protect the integrity of the property.
How long does sinkhole filling usually take? The duration varies depending on the size and complexity of the sinkhole, but local pros can provide an estimate after inspection.
Can sinkholes be prevented? While not all sinkholes can be prevented, proper land management and drainage practices can reduce the risk of formation in susceptible areas.
